  1. Executive Summary
    Noodlesco Ltd is a micro-sized private limited company operating within the broadly defined "Other service activities not elsewhere classified" segment. Since its incorporation in 2020, it has demonstrated steady improvement in its financial position, growing net assets significantly from £753 in 2020 to £51,641 in 2024, reflecting effective working capital management and likely operational scaling under a single director-owner structure.
